[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Pspp-cvs] Changes to pspp/src/ChangeLog
From: |
Ben Pfaff |
Subject: |
[Pspp-cvs] Changes to pspp/src/ChangeLog |
Date: |
Mon, 14 Mar 2005 01:54:41 -0500 |
Index: pspp/src/ChangeLog
diff -u pspp/src/ChangeLog:1.159 pspp/src/ChangeLog:1.160
--- pspp/src/ChangeLog:1.159 Sun Mar 13 07:31:53 2005
+++ pspp/src/ChangeLog Mon Mar 14 06:54:40 2005
@@ -1,3 +1,53 @@
+Sun Mar 13 22:52:05 2005 Ben Pfaff <address@hidden>
+
+ * file-handle.q: (struct file_handle) `open_mode' should not be
+ const.
+
+Sun Mar 13 22:40:54 2005 Ben Pfaff <address@hidden>
+
+ First phase of making SORT CASES stable (PR 12035).
+
+ * sort.c: (struct indexed_case) New structure.
+ (do_internal_sort) Rewrite to make internal sorting stable.
+ (compare_case_dblptrs) Removed.
+ (compare_indexed_cases) New function.
+
+Sun Mar 13 22:38:40 2005 Ben Pfaff <address@hidden>
+
+ Clean-ups.
+
+ * casefile.c: (casereader_read_xfer_assert) New function.
+
+ * dictionary.c: (dict_compact_case) New function.
+
+ * flip.c: (struct flip_pgm) New member idx_to_fv.
+ (cmd_flip) Initialize idx_to_fv member.
+ (destroy_flip_pgm) Free idx_to_fv member.
+ (flip_sink_write) Use struct flip_pgm member instead of case_sink
+ member.
+ (flip_sink_write) Ditto.
+
+ * vfm.c: (write_case) Use dict_compact_case() instead of
+ compact_case().
+ (compact_case) Removed.
+ (storage_source_create) Removed `dict' parameter. All references
+ updated.
+
+ * vfm.h: (struct case_source) Removed `value_cnt' member. All
+ references removed.
+ (struct case_sink) Removed `dict', `idx_to_fv' members. All
+ references removed.
+
+Sun Mar 13 22:35:55 2005 Ben Pfaff <address@hidden>
+
+ More AGGREGATE fixes.
+
+ * aggregate.c: (accumulate_aggregate_info) Implement NMISS and
+ NUMISS for strings. Fix FOUT, POUT, FGT, FLT, FIN, FOUT for
+ strings.
+ (initialize_aggregate_info) Fix initialization for MIN, MAX for
+ strings.
+
Sat Mar 12 23:26:21 2005 Ben Pfaff <address@hidden>
Start work on testing and debugging AGGREGATE.
- [Pspp-cvs] Changes to pspp/src/ChangeLog, (continued)
- [Pspp-cvs] Changes to pspp/src/ChangeLog, Ben Pfaff, 2005/03/07
- [Pspp-cvs] Changes to pspp/src/ChangeLog, Ben Pfaff, 2005/03/07
- [Pspp-cvs] Changes to pspp/src/ChangeLog, John Darrington, 2005/03/08
- [Pspp-cvs] Changes to pspp/src/ChangeLog, Ben Pfaff, 2005/03/09
- [Pspp-cvs] Changes to pspp/src/ChangeLog, Ben Pfaff, 2005/03/11
- [Pspp-cvs] Changes to pspp/src/ChangeLog, Ben Pfaff, 2005/03/12
- [Pspp-cvs] Changes to pspp/src/ChangeLog, Ben Pfaff, 2005/03/12
- [Pspp-cvs] Changes to pspp/src/ChangeLog, Ben Pfaff, 2005/03/12
- [Pspp-cvs] Changes to pspp/src/ChangeLog, John Darrington, 2005/03/13
- [Pspp-cvs] Changes to pspp/src/ChangeLog, Ben Pfaff, 2005/03/13
- [Pspp-cvs] Changes to pspp/src/ChangeLog,
Ben Pfaff <=
- [Pspp-cvs] Changes to pspp/src/ChangeLog, Ben Pfaff, 2005/03/15
- [Pspp-cvs] Changes to pspp/src/ChangeLog, Ben Pfaff, 2005/03/19
- [Pspp-cvs] Changes to pspp/src/ChangeLog, Ben Pfaff, 2005/03/20